Understanding Self-Esteem

Self-esteem is a fundamental aspect of our psychological makeup, influencing how we perceive ourselves and interact with the world. It is the subjective evaluation of one's worth and abilities and can significantly impact various life domains, including relationships, career, and overall well-being.

The Components of Self-Esteem

Self-esteem comprises several components that collectively shape an individual's self-perception:

  • Self-Worth: The intrinsic value an individual assigns to themselves, irrespective of external achievements or validation.
  • Self-Confidence: The belief in one's abilities to accomplish tasks and face challenges.
  • Self-Respect: The regard one holds for themselves, often reflected in their ability to set boundaries and maintain personal integrity.
  • Self-Competence: The perception of being effective in various activities and roles.

The Importance of Healthy Self-Esteem

A healthy level of self-esteem is crucial for several reasons:

  • Resilience: Individuals with high self-esteem are better equipped to handle stress and setbacks.
  • Positive Relationships: Healthy self-esteem fosters more balanced and fulfilling interpersonal relationships.
  • Motivation: A positive self-view encourages individuals to pursue goals and take on new challenges.
  • Mental Health: High self-esteem is associated with lower rates of anxiety, depression, and other mental health issues.

Challenges in Developing Self-Esteem

While some people naturally develop a robust sense of self-esteem, others may struggle due to various factors:

External Influences

Societal norms, media portrayals, and cultural expectations can significantly impact self-esteem. For example:

  • Media Representation: Unrealistic standards of beauty and success can create feelings of inadequacy.
  • Peer Pressure: Social comparisons and the need for acceptance can erode self-worth.
  • Cultural Norms: Societal expectations regarding gender roles, career success, and lifestyle can influence self-perception.

Internal Factors

Personal experiences and psychological predispositions also play a role in shaping self-esteem:

  • Childhood Experiences: Negative experiences such as bullying, neglect, or criticism can leave lasting impacts.
  • Perfectionism: Setting unrealistically high standards for oneself can lead to chronic dissatisfaction.
  • Negative Self-Talk: Internalizing critical or pessimistic thoughts can diminish self-esteem.

Methods and Techniques in Online Counseling for Self-Esteem

Various therapeutic approaches can be employed in online counseling to address self-esteem issues. Here are some commonly used methods:

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y (CBT)

CBT is a widely recognized approach for addressing self-esteem issues. It focuses on identifying and challenging negative thought patterns:

  • Thought Records: Clients track negative thoughts and identify cognitive distortions.
  • Reframing: Therapists help clients reframe negative thoughts into more balanced perspectives.
  • Behavioral Experiments: Clients test the validity of their negative beliefs through real-life experiments.

Mindfulness-Based Approaches

Mindfulness techniques can be highly effective in enhancing self-esteem by promoting present-moment awareness and self-acceptance:

  • Meditation: Guided meditation sessions help clients develop a non-judgmental awareness of their thoughts and feelings.
  • Body Scan: This technique encourages clients to focus on physical sensations, fostering a deeper connection with their bodies.
  • Gratitude Journaling: Clients maintain a journal of things they are grateful for, shifting focus from negative to positive aspects of life.

Solution-Focused Brief Therapy (SFBT)

SFBT is a goal-oriented approach that emphasizes solutions rather than problems:

  • Goal Setting: Clients identify specific, achievable goals related to their self-esteem.
  • Strengths Identification: Therapists help clients recognize and leverage their strengths and past successes.
  • Scaling Questions: Clients assess their progress by rating their confidence levels on a scale.

Psychodynamic Therapy

This approach explores unconscious processes and past experiences that may be influencing current self-esteem issues:

  • Exploration of Childhood: Therapists delve into early experiences and relationships to uncover root causes.
  • Dream Analysis: Clients discuss their dreams, which can reveal hidden emotions and conflicts.
  • Transference and Countertransference: The therapeutic relationship itself is used to understand and resolve underlying issues.
